Unit Testing Crash Course
This month Matthew Weier O'Phinney, Project Lead for Zend Framework,
will give a unit testing crash course, showing the theory and basics
around unit testing, including strategies for testing existing
codebases, testing bugfixes, and Test Driven Development (TDD). Much

Hello out there! I am having an issue that I am hoping someone out there has pointers for resolving. We have an email newsletter which we send to encourage customers to visit our site. In the email, we provide article teasers and links to the articles allowing people to "read more". The articles are protected such that people have to be a member to read them. The problem we are encountering is that customers click the link, login, and then they are routed to the home page rather than to the article.

Easy Problems are the Hard Problems
Special guest Paul Reinheimer takes an in-depth look at the easy/hard
parts of web applications.
Consider "Easy" problems in web applications, like login forms. On the
surface, terribly simple, slap some escaping functions on a query and
you're done! Well, not quite, what about brute force login attempts?
Locking accounts? Captachas!

Thanks to Bear Code for chips, salsa and hospitality.
Small group. Much discussion on CSS and theming. (I'll let other folks fill in here.) Headlines ... Beauty of using Zen theme as a base for theme development because of the preprocess hook and its light structure .... Advantage of using Firebug to decipher CSS hierarchies...
